Bought my 06 tC in may 2006 with 53 miles on it, now up to 210,000+ miles. No major issues what so ever. I still have the original car battery, which is impressive. I did have to add some distilled water into it after 6 years, no big feat there. I have a short RAM intake, Borla axle back exhaust, which after adding bumped my MPG to about 31-33 hwy. Most of my driving is hwy, my daily commute is 60 mi each way. and I drive frequently from San Diego to Sacramento, roughly 550 mi each way. The tC is comfortable enough to drive the whole way with no problems. I'm 5'10". Very easy to maintain. Easy access to the oil filter, I always check the placement of that on cars before buying.

I bought my car new in 2006 with 20 miles on it. I now have put 170,000 miles on it and the only issue I have had is the trunk handle breaking, which is a very common problem. Other than that it has run perfectly and not cost me an extra penny beyond standard maintenance. I'm going to keep driving it until the tires fall off which probably won't be for awhile. I certainly have gotten my money out of this car.

This car is GREAT in most areas. I have had it for 6 years and put 118k miles on it. No maintenance except normal wear and tear. What's not so great is: the car is noisy, the sound dampening is nonexistent. The ride is harder than it should be. The main thing that is infuriating is that it is impossible to see the speedometer/tach/gas/temp in the day time as the instruments are recessed too much. If the car and the sun have the "right" aspect you can see the guages but turn a corner and you can't. However I love this car.

When looking for a new car, I had a little list of things that I was looking for 1) Looks 2) Reliability 3) Good gas mileage 4) Fun to drive. The car that always seemed to stand out was the Scion tC. What put the tC over the top for me was the Release Series 2.0. The color is awesome and the alcantara seats are just as great. Mechanically, the car is solid. It's definitely not a sports car, but drives extremely smoothly and quiet. Its handling is OK, but accurate. There is a lot more room on the inside than it looks. The back seats have tons of leg and hip room, but the head room is a little lacking. This is a great daily driver that gives you what you need and some stuff you want without costing a ton. If you see many tCs on the road, it's for a reason.
